Let's start with a little information about inclinations. Once you have created your main pawn, you will be asked a series of questions, each answer leading the pawn to two different inclinations - primary and secondary. From now on, your pawn will react first to their primary inclination and then, obviously, to their secondary.

Pawn Inclination are a characteristic of pawns that affect their behaviors in the field and in battle. Inclinations can vary from bravely aggressive, protective of other pawns and the Arisen, to cautious or adventurous. There are nine possible inclinations. Inclinations are an easily overlooked and important aspect of pawn behavior - the interactions can be …Offensive inclination (such as Challenger, Mitigator)/Medicant - Heals when health drops less than one-third total. Offensive inclination/Offensive inclination/Medicant - Heals at critical. A pawn doesn't have to have Medicant in its inclinations to use Anodyne correctly-- it merely determines how quickly the pawn responds to injuries. Medicant in the first position means it will interrupt whatever it's doing at the smallest loss of HP from any party member; the further it's down, the more of a battlemage it will be.

Inclination Elixirs are potions that the Arisens can use to change their Main Pawn 's inclination . All Inclination Elixirs can be bought from Johnathan's Rift Shop in The Encampment for 250 Rift Crystals, except for the Neutralizing Elixir which costs 500 Rift Crystals.
